A SUBMARINE, yachts, pilot cutters and warships were all to be seen on Cwmbran Boating Lake on Sunday.

All, of course, were models, lovingly created by their owners and brought to the lake to celebrate Cwmbran Modelling Society's 30th anniversary. Model boat enthusiasts from the society were joined by several other clubs, to enjoy a day of sailing on the lake, in Llanyravon.

Club secretary Colin Mackie said there were around 40 boats altogether, including several from clubs from Gloucestershire, Droitwich, Portishead and Cardiff.

"It was a good turnout. "We cordoned off part of the lake for boats that children could have a go with and that was very popular. It seemed to be in use all day."

He said there was a huge variety of craft, including fishing boats, cabin cruisers, speed boats and even a submarine.

It was the sixth time the society has held its annual open day when they take over the whole lake and invite other clubs to join them.

There are presently around 45 members of the Cwmbran society, who meet at the lake every Sunday between 10am and 1pm.
